Output 68e4506a64cf7f8b29c14c77206f70dea242070c17c789d351fc62ceaa23e496:0

value
1200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e444dcefa6ec662e956ee04348aa9886ef93ab91 OP_EQUALVERIFY OP_CHECKSIG
address
1MoyZRdaVzF6nFbokTh7dTUZpZchHZFDZC
transaction
68e4506a64cf7f8b29c14c77206f70dea242070c17c789d351fc62ceaa23e496
spent
true